INTRODUCTION Carbon footprint originated from the terminology of ecological footprint which was proposed by Wackernagel and Rees, 1996 (Wackernagel and Rees, 1996). It is the calculation of the total value of direct or indirect CO 2 emissions of the activities occur during the life cycle. According to another definition, it is a technique to identify and measure of the greenhouse gas emissions (GHG) release from each operation or activity full life cycle (Carbon Trust, 2007; IPCC, 2006; IPCC, 2007). Grubb and Ellis, 2007, defined carbon footprint as the total amount of carbon dioxide release through the combustion of fossil fuels. The major greenhouse gases emitted into the atmosphere are CO 2, CH 4, N 2 O and some different fluorine containing halogenated compounds (Muthu, 2014). However, the most significant greenhouse gas is CO 2 and it was produced from burning of fossil fuels to generate energy which is essential for the manufacture and transport of the goods. It is expressed as grams or kilograms of CO 2 equivalent per kilowatt hour of generation (g/kgCO 2eq /kWh) which being in charge of the different global warming effects of other greenhouse gases (Paliamentary Office of Science and Technology (POST), 2006). Hammond, 2007 suggested that ...” The property that is often referred to as a carbon footprint is actually a carbon weight of kilograms or tonnes per person or activity.” Higher GHG concentrations in the earth`s atmosphere cause global warming and it causes climate change in the world.
